FAQs
Here are some common questions parents have before reaching out to us for more information.
Circumcision is a surgical procedure that removes the foreskin from the penis. It is commonly performed on newborns for various medical and cultural reasons. The procedure is quick, safe, and typically performed under local anesthesia.
While any surgical procedure can cause discomfort, we prioritize minimizing pain. Local anesthesia is used to ensure your baby feels no pain during the circumcision. Post-procedure care includes pain management strategies to keep your baby comfortable.
The best age is between 1 week to 6 weeks after birth. Babies of this age tolerate the procedure extremely will with very rapid healing and very low risk of bleeding or infection.
Like any procedure, circumcision carries some risks, such as bleeding or infection. However, these complications are rare when performed by a qualified professional. Dr. Rapoport follows strict safety protocols to ensure the highest level of care.
Preparation for circumcision is straightforward. We will provide you with detailed instructions on how to care for your baby before and after the procedure. Ensuring your baby is healthy and well-fed prior to the appointment is essential.
